After hearing that we would be receiving a “Flabongo” to review we were pretty much expecting a pink flamingo yard decoration with the legs crudely hacked off and the beak sawed off and that is basically what we got, but it was definitely not as “crude” as we expected and it does what it”s supposed to, act as a beer bong. It”s not quite as large as the pink flamingos you would normally see sitting on some old ladies yard, but it still holds about 3 beers when completely full. We”re not sure if the flabongo is manufactured without the legs and beak, but from what we can tell it is not. Read More…

This thing looks insane. KegFast offers 3 versions of their tap, a 2 hose model, 4 hose model, and 6 hose model. They were kind enough to send us a 4 hose model for testing. They also offer taps for every type of keg you can think of, as well as different methods of attaching them to the keg, lever, twist, etc. So it”s basically what you think of when you think of a multi-output keg tap. Well this is impressive. Kegger Industries was nice enough to hook us up with one of these to review and upon receiving it, we were blown away. The quality of the keg coat is incredible. It feels like the outer shell is made of a material similar to a scuba wet suit. The inner lining is a plastic type material that is also used inside those small soft coolers. So with that in mind, there is no doubt in our minds that this keg coat, will be able to keep our keg cold for a long amount of time without ice. They claim up to 7-8 hours without ice, but honestly what college party has a keg last more than a few hours, so this could be perfect. For our review we are going to get a cold keg, measure the temperature at the start, then place it in the keg coat. Then every 30 minutes we will measure the temperature of a beer to see how well the keg coat is working.
